On 2017-02-09 12:32, Joerg Roedel wrote:
> From: Joerg Roedel <jroedel@suse.de>
>
> Register Exynos IOMMUs to the IOMMU core and make them
> visible in sysfs. This patch does not add the links between
> IOMMUs and translated devices yet.
>
> Cc: Marek Szyprowski <m.szyprowski@samsung.com>
> Cc: linux-arm-kernel@lists.infradead.org
> Cc: linux-samsung-soc@vger.kernel.org
> Signed-off-by: Joerg Roedel <jroedel@suse.de>

Acked-by: Marek Szyprowski <m.szyprowski@samsung.com>
Tested-by: Marek Szyprowski <m.szyprowski@samsung.com>

> ---
>   drivers/iommu/exynos-iommu.c | 14 ++++++++++++++
>   1 file changed, 14 insertions(+)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/iommu/exynos-iommu.c b/drivers/iommu/exynos-iommu.c
> index 57ba0d3..64325d8 100644
> --- a/drivers/iommu/exynos-iommu.c
> +++ b/drivers/iommu/exynos-iommu.c
> @@ -276,6 +276,8 @@ struct sysmmu_drvdata {
>   	struct list_head owner_node;	/* node for owner controllers list */
>   	phys_addr_t pgtable;		/* assigned page table structure */
>   	unsigned int version;		/* our version */
> +
> +	struct iommu_device iommu;	/* IOMMU core handle */
>   };
>   
>   static struct exynos_iommu_domain *to_exynos_domain(struct iommu_domain *dom)
> @@ -611,6 +613,18 @@ static int __init exynos_sysmmu_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
>   	data->sysmmu = dev;
>   	spin_lock_init(&data->lock);
>   
> +	ret = iommu_device_sysfs_add(&data->iommu, &pdev->dev, NULL,
> +				     dev_name(data->sysmmu));
> +	if (ret)
> +		return ret;
> +
> +	iommu_device_set_ops(&data->iommu, &exynos_iommu_ops);
> +	iommu_device_set_fwnode(&data->iommu, &dev->of_node->fwnode);
> +
> +	ret = iommu_device_register(&data->iommu);
> +	if (ret)
> +		return ret;
> +
>   	platform_set_drvdata(pdev, data);
>   
>   	__sysmmu_get_version(data);
